WebApr 12, 2024 · Both glucagon and milrinone increase myocardial intracellular cAMP levels, thereby exerting positive inotropic and chronotropic effects. These agents bypass the beta-receptor, making them particularly attractive for patients with BBl poisoning. candidates for glucagon/milrinone therapy? WebMilrinone increases cardiac index with reductions in arterial pressure, left ventricular end-diastolic pressure, and PVR. Heart rate can increase, although this is not a consistent response and bradycardia can also occur.
